1. Skettis – Terokkar Forest

Skettis is one of the most reliable gold farms in the game.
What makes it great:
  • Constant elite mob spawns
  • Valuable Shadow Dust & Arcane Tomes
  • High cloth and green drop rate
You can easily farm 150–250 gold per hour here with a geared character, especially if you sell the reputation items on the Auction House.

2. Shadowmoon Valley – Elemental Plateau

Elementals are gold machines in TBC.
They drop:
  • Primal Fire
  • Primal Shadow
  • Motes and greens
These primals are used in almost every endgame craft. Even late in the expansion, prices stay high. This spot is perfect for both solo players and small groups.

3. Netherstorm – Manaforges

Manaforges are stacked with:
  • Ethereal mobs
  • Mana-themed elementals
  • High vendor trash
You’ll farm:
  • Netherweave Cloth
  • Arcane Tomes
  • Primal Mana
If you have AoE abilities, this is one of the fastest raw gold zones in the game.

4. Blade’s Edge Mountains – Bash’ir Landing

This area is often overlooked, which is why it’s so profitable.
You get:
  • Etherium Prison Keys
  • Bash’ir Phasing Devices
  • Valuable vendor items
The loot from these mobs adds up fast, especially on low-pop layers.

5. Karazhan Trash Farming

If you’re raid-geared, Karazhan trash farming is insane gold.
You can farm:
  • BoE epics
  • Rare patterns
  • High-value vendor trash
A good group can make thousands of gold per reset just from trash and drops.

How to Maximize Your Gold Per Hour

To get the most from these spots:
  • Farm during off-peak hours
  • Use gathering professions
  • Always check Auction House prices
  • Avoid crowded layers
Gold farming isn’t just about killing mobs — it’s about selling smart.
